As Vice President of Programming I oversee the Linfield Activities Board (LAB) which organizes events that occur both on and off-campus. LAB consists of six chairs which are: Special Events, Cultural Events, Health and Outdoor Programming, Musical Entertainment, Audio/Visual Equipment Coordinator and Secretary. LAB provides Linfield diverse, enjoyable and inexpernsive activities that foster a sense of community on campus.
